Technical Analysis: Short-Term Prospects for ICICI Bank

The technical indicators reveal interesting insights for ICICI Bank’s stock.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) is at 54.67, indicating a neutral trend, neither overbought nor oversold. The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) stands at 5.11, suggesting a positive momentum.

In terms of volatility, the Average True Range (ATR) is observed at 17.13, pointing to moderate fluctuations. Bollinger Bands show upper and lower limits of ₹1,402.93 and ₹1,350.54 respectively, suggesting potential breakouts. These factors collectively signal cautious optimism for ICICI’s short-term trajectory.
